Course program
- Basics of hydraulic drives in mobile systems:
- general design and characteristics of mobile hydraulic drives
- basics of hydromechanics
- pressure losses in hydraulic systems
- Positive displacement pumps:
- classification, design and operation principles of gear pumps, vane pumps and axial piston pumps
- design solutions of positive displacement pumps
- criteria for selection of positive displacement pumps
- Hydraulic cylinders:
- classification, design and operation principles of hydraulic cylinders
- cylinder design solutions
- seals
- criteria for selection
- Positive displacement rotary hydraulic motors:
- design solutions of low-torque and high torque motors
- criteria for selection of hydraulic motors
- Hydraulic valves in mobile applications:
- Flow control valves:
- general information about the distributors
- distributor design solutionsy
- indirect control of distributors
- design solutions of cut-off valves, check valves and controlled check valves
- hydrostatic steering valves - Orbitrol
- Pressure control valves:
- general information about pressure valves
- construction solutions and operating principles of safety and bypass valves, reducing valves, differential valves, connecting and disconnecting valves
- stop valves
- indirect control of pressure valves
- Flow rate control valves:
- design and operation principles of throttle valves
- 2-way and 3-way flow regulators
- Flow dividers
- Priority valves
- Integrated control blocks in mobile applications
- Criteria for selection of hydraulic valves
- Flow control valves:
- Hydraulic accumulators:
- classification and operation principles of accumulators
- application of accumulators in mobile systems
- filling and charging gas accumulators
- criteria for selection of accumulators
- Working fluids applied in hydrostatic mobile systems:
- types of working fluids in hydraulic devices
- quality and viscosity classification of working fluids
- criteria for selection of working fluids h
- Conditioning elements for working fluids:
- classification and design of filters
- location of filters in mobile hydraulic systems
- design solutions of hydraulic filters
- criteria for selection of filters
- air and water coolers
- heaters
- Connections of hydraulic devices:
- Types of cables
- Connecting elements (connectors)
- Special element mounting systems
- Criteria for selection of cables
- seals in hydraulic elements
- Working fluid tanks in mobile applications:
- design of tanks and hydraulic power packs
- criteria for selection of tanks
- Hydraulic system auxiliaries::
- pressure relays
- time relays
- seals
- criteria for selection of seals
- Graphical symbols of hydraulic elements and control systems
- Reading and interpretation of simple schematic diagrams of hydraulic systems
- Practical exercises on training positions– examination of exploitation properties of hydraulic elements in mobile applications
- Using FluidSIM H software to present the functions of the hydraulic elements

Software
The teaching process is being supported by Fluid-SIM H. The software helps to learn the principles of the design and simulation of hydraulic and electrohydraulic control systems. The software enables analyzing the increase of the level and rate of the flow, pressure drops in the valves as well as designating the velocity and accelerations of the cylinder’s pistons.
